CALLING ALL ARTISTS AND ARTS ORGANIZATIONS
Here is an opportunity for you to express your talents, get involved in the 
community, gain some great exposure and perhaps make some extra cash.

In place of my annual summer party, I am coordinating a street wide sale that 
will take place Saturday, August 3 from 9 a.m. - 6 p.m.  This sale will 
include the participation of over 200 households and neighborhood businesses 
on W. 99th Street.

My vision is to take the event to the next level and create a festival-type 
atmosphere.  In addition to the sale, I would like to invite artists of all 
descriptions to perform and setup shop on the street corners.  With the 
event's exposure and foot traffic this will be a perfect opportunity for all 
types of artists (e.g., musicians, face painters, jewelry makers, balloon 
twisters, mimes, etc.) and arts organizations to get involved.

We have a lot of children in the neighborhood who have no creative outlets to 
express themselves.  I invite you to use this opportunity to create and share 
your talents with others.  Whether you want to draw chalk figures on the 
sidewalks, perform a skit, or modern dance across the lawn, the opportunity 
is for you to take advantage of.

Earlier this month, a friend and I went door-to-door passing out flyers 
informing each household and business on W. 99th Street that the event is 
scheduled (there will be another flyer distribution in July).  I've also put 
out a request for households to contact me if they would be willing to "host 
an artist(s)" on their sidewalk/driveway or front lawn. 

This event will be promoted through classified advertising, flyers and media 
exposure.  Hundreds of people are expected to attend and I'm currently 
working on getting Mayor Campbell to make an appearance.  This is a rain or 
shine event and the street will NOT be blocked off.
